UPDATE: Longwood joins Big South Conference
[Image: longwood%2Blancers.jpeg]

FARMVILLE, Va. --
Longwood University on Monday afternoon announced at an on-campus press conference that it will become the Big South Conference’s 12th member on July 1. The league also includes Virginia schools VMI, Radford and Liberty.

The Lancers have competed on the Division I level since 2007, but have done so as an independent. Longwood’s inclusion in the Big South will limit travel time and allow access to league championships and automatic bids to NCAA championships, among other advantages

Could Campbell potentially drop any men's sports to reinvest in football? It looks like they have ten men's sports, so if they drop soccer, wrestling, indoor track, and outdoor track, that keeps them at six men's sports and frees up 26.4 scholarships - Campbell would need 5.1 more (50% of 63 = 31.5) for football to count towards Division I membership requirements, and 30.6 more to count towards bowl eligibility for their FBS opponents.
